VFN 4" WS6 hood is now installed!!! PICS->
I managed to get my car over to VFN last night and the VFN guys, Armando and Lane installed the hood.
<img src="https://ls1tech.com/psjpics/images/prostockhood1.jpg" alt=" - " />
<img src="https://ls1tech.com/psjpics/images/prostockhood2.jpg" alt=" - " />
The hood looks fantastic on the car, the lines of the hood really work with the fender lines and bumper. Lane raked the nostrils back and now the nostrils appear taller and wider but still use OEM grills.
I think the final weight of the hood was 27 lbs, and that was before any mods. I plan to cut out part of the back (VFN offers this an option) and install some of their rear grills... And I plan to make a custom airbox too.
I went to 7-11 last nite on my way home (11pm). When I came out there were 3-4 guys checking out the car because of the hood. <img border="0" title="" alt="[Wink]" src="gr_images/icons/wink.gif" />
